/*
* Copyright (c) 2010 The WebM project authors. All Rights Reserved.
*
* Use of this source code is governed by a BSD-style license
* that can be found in the LICENSE file in the root of the source
* tree. An additional intellectual property rights grant can be found
* in the file PATENTS. All contributing project authors may
* be found in the AUTHORS file in the root of the source tree.
*/
#include "vpx_config.h"
#include "vpx_ports/x86.h"
#include "vp8/common/subpixel.h"
#include "vp8/common/loopfilter.h"
#include "vp8/common/recon.h"
#include "vp8/common/idct.h"
#include "vp8/common/variance.h"
#include "vp8/common/pragmas.h"
#include "vp8/common/onyxc_int.h"
void vp8_arch_x86_common_init(VP8_COMMON *ctx)
{
#if CONFIG_RUNTIME_CPU_DETECT
VP8_COMMON_RTCD *rtcd = &ctx->rtcd;
int flags = x86_simd_caps();
/* Note:
*
* This platform can be built without runtime CPU detection as well. If
* you modify any of the function mappings present in this file, be sure
* to also update them in static mapings (<arch>/filename_<arch>.h)
*/
/* Override default functions with fastest ones for this CPU. */
#if HAVE_MMX
if (flags & HAS_MMX)
{
rtcd->dequant.block = vp8_dequantize_b_mmx;
rtcd->dequant.idct_add = vp8_dequant_idct_add_mmx;
rtcd->dequant.idct_add_y_block = vp8_dequant_idct_add_y_block_mmx;
rtcd->dequant.idct_add_uv_block = vp8_dequant_idct_add_uv_block_mmx;
rtcd->idct.idct16 = vp8_short_idct4x4llm_mmx;
rtcd->idct.idct1_scalar_add = vp8_dc_only_idct_add_mmx;
rtcd->idct.iwalsh16 = vp8_short_inv_walsh4x4_mmx;
rtcd->recon.copy8x8 = vp8_copy_mem8x8_mmx;
rtcd->recon.copy8x4 = vp8_copy_mem8x4_mmx;
rtcd->recon.copy16x16 = vp8_copy_mem16x16_mmx;
rtcd->subpix.sixtap16x16 = vp8_sixtap_predict16x16_mmx;
rtcd->subpix.sixtap8x8 = vp8_sixtap_predict8x8_mmx;
rtcd->subpix.sixtap8x4 = vp8_sixtap_predict8x4_mmx;
rtcd->subpix.sixtap4x4 = vp8_sixtap_predict4x4_mmx;
rtcd->subpix.bilinear16x16 = vp8_bilinear_predict16x16_mmx;
rtcd->subpix.bilinear8x8 = vp8_bilinear_predict8x8_mmx;
rtcd->subpix.bilinear8x4 = vp8_bilinear_predict8x4_mmx;
rtcd->subpix.bilinear4x4 = vp8_bilinear_predict4x4_mmx;
rtcd->loopfilter.normal_mb_v = vp8_loop_filter_mbv_mmx;
rtcd->loopfilter.normal_b_v = vp8_loop_filter_bv_mmx;
rtcd->loopfilter.normal_mb_h = vp8_loop_filter_mbh_mmx;
rtcd->loopfilter.normal_b_h = vp8_loop_filter_bh_mmx;
rtcd->loopfilter.simple_mb_v = vp8_loop_filter_simple_vertical_edge_mmx;
rtcd->loopfilter.simple_b_v = vp8_loop_filter_bvs_mmx;
rtcd->loopfilter.simple_mb_h = vp8_loop_filter_simple_horizontal_edge_mmx;
rtcd->loopfilter.simple_b_h = vp8_loop_filter_bhs_mmx;
rtcd->variance.sad16x16 = vp8_sad16x16_mmx;
rtcd->variance.sad16x8 = vp8_sad16x8_mmx;
rtcd->variance.sad8x16 = vp8_sad8x16_mmx;
rtcd->variance.sad8x8 = vp8_sad8x8_mmx;
rtcd->variance.sad4x4 = vp8_sad4x4_mmx;
rtcd->variance.var4x4 = vp8_variance4x4_mmx;
rtcd->variance.var8x8 = vp8_variance8x8_mmx;
rtcd->variance.var8x16 = vp8_variance8x16_mmx;
rtcd->variance.var16x8 = vp8_variance16x8_mmx;
rtcd->variance.var16x16 = vp8_variance16x16_mmx;
rtcd->variance.subpixvar4x4 = vp8_sub_pixel_variance4x4_mmx;
rtcd->variance.subpixvar8x8 = vp8_sub_pixel_variance8x8_mmx;
rtcd->variance.subpixvar8x16 = vp8_sub_pixel_variance8x16_mmx;
rtcd->variance.subpixvar16x8 = vp8_sub_pixel_variance16x8_mmx;
rtcd->variance.subpixvar16x16 = vp8_sub_pixel_variance16x16_mmx;
rtcd->variance.halfpixvar16x16_h = vp8_variance_halfpixvar16x16_h_mmx;
rtcd->variance.halfpixvar16x16_v = vp8_variance_halfpixvar16x16_v_mmx;
rtcd->variance.halfpixvar16x16_hv = vp8_variance_halfpixvar16x16_hv_mmx;
rtcd->variance.subpixmse16x16 = vp8_sub_pixel_mse16x16_mmx;
rtcd->variance.mse16x16 = vp8_mse16x16_mmx;
rtcd->variance.getmbss = vp8_get_mb_ss_mmx;
rtcd->variance.get4x4sse_cs = vp8_get4x4sse_cs_mmx;
#if CONFIG_POSTPROC
rtcd->postproc.down = vp8_mbpost_proc_down_mmx;
/*rtcd->postproc.across = vp8_mbpost_proc_across_ip_c;*/
rtcd->postproc.downacross = vp8_post_proc_down_and_across_mmx;
rtcd->postproc.addnoise = vp8_plane_add_noise_mmx;
#endif
}
#endif
#if HAVE_SSE2
if (flags & HAS_SSE2)
{
rtcd->recon.copy16x16 = vp8_copy_mem16x16_sse2;
rtcd->recon.build_intra_predictors_mbuv =
vp8_build_intra_predictors_mbuv_sse2;
rtcd->recon.build_intra_predictors_mbuv_s =
vp8_build_intra_predictors_mbuv_s_sse2;
rtcd->recon.build_intra_predictors_mby =
vp8_build_intra_predictors_mby_sse2;
rtcd->recon.build_intra_predictors_mby_s =
vp8_build_intra_predictors_mby_s_sse2;
rtcd->dequant.idct_add_y_block = vp8_dequant_idct_add_y_block_sse2;
rtcd->dequant.idct_add_uv_block = vp8_dequant_idct_add_uv_block_sse2;
rtcd->idct.iwalsh16 = vp8_short_inv_walsh4x4_sse2;
rtcd->subpix.sixtap16x16 = vp8_sixtap_predict16x16_sse2;
rtcd->subpix.sixtap8x8 = vp8_sixtap_predict8x8_sse2;
rtcd->subpix.sixtap8x4 = vp8_sixtap_predict8x4_sse2;
rtcd->subpix.bilinear16x16 = vp8_bilinear_predict16x16_sse2;
rtcd->subpix.bilinear8x8 = vp8_bilinear_predict8x8_sse2;
rtcd->loopfilter.normal_mb_v = vp8_loop_filter_mbv_sse2;
rtcd->loopfilter.normal_b_v = vp8_loop_filter_bv_sse2;
rtcd->loopfilter.normal_mb_h = vp8_loop_filter_mbh_sse2;
rtcd->loopfilter.normal_b_h = vp8_loop_filter_bh_sse2;
rtcd->loopfilter.simple_mb_v = vp8_loop_filter_simple_vertical_edge_sse2;
rtcd->loopfilter.simple_b_v = vp8_loop_filter_bvs_sse2;
rtcd->loopfilter.simple_mb_h = vp8_loop_filter_simple_horizontal_edge_sse2;
rtcd->loopfilter.simple_b_h = vp8_loop_filter_bhs_sse2;
rtcd->variance.sad16x16 = vp8_sad16x16_wmt;
rtcd->variance.sad16x8 = vp8_sad16x8_wmt;
rtcd->variance.sad8x16 = vp8_sad8x16_wmt;
rtcd->variance.sad8x8 = vp8_sad8x8_wmt;
rtcd->variance.sad4x4 = vp8_sad4x4_wmt;
rtcd->variance.copy32xn = vp8_copy32xn_sse2;
rtcd->variance.var4x4 = vp8_variance4x4_wmt;
rtcd->variance.var8x8 = vp8_variance8x8_wmt;
rtcd->variance.var8x16 = vp8_variance8x16_wmt;
rtcd->variance.var16x8 = vp8_variance16x8_wmt;
rtcd->variance.var16x16 = vp8_variance16x16_wmt;
rtcd->variance.subpixvar4x4 = vp8_sub_pixel_variance4x4_wmt;
rtcd->variance.subpixvar8x8 = vp8_sub_pixel_variance8x8_wmt;
rtcd->variance.subpixvar8x16 = vp8_sub_pixel_variance8x16_wmt;
rtcd->variance.subpixvar16x8 = vp8_sub_pixel_variance16x8_wmt;
rtcd->variance.subpixvar16x16 = vp8_sub_pixel_variance16x16_wmt;
rtcd->variance.halfpixvar16x16_h = vp8_variance_halfpixvar16x16_h_wmt;
rtcd->variance.halfpixvar16x16_v = vp8_variance_halfpixvar16x16_v_wmt;
rtcd->variance.halfpixvar16x16_hv = vp8_variance_halfpixvar16x16_hv_wmt;
rtcd->variance.subpixmse16x16 = vp8_sub_pixel_mse16x16_wmt;
rtcd->variance.mse16x16 = vp8_mse16x16_wmt;
rtcd->variance.getmbss = vp8_get_mb_ss_sse2;
/* rtcd->variance.get4x4sse_cs not implemented for wmt */;
#if CONFIG_INTERNAL_STATS
#if ARCH_X86_64
rtcd->variance.ssimpf_8x8 = vp8_ssim_parms_8x8_sse2;
rtcd->variance.ssimpf_16x16 = vp8_ssim_parms_16x16_sse2;
#endif
#endif
#if CONFIG_POSTPROC
rtcd->postproc.down = vp8_mbpost_proc_down_xmm;
rtcd->postproc.across = vp8_mbpost_proc_across_ip_xmm;
rtcd->postproc.downacross = vp8_post_proc_down_and_across_xmm;
rtcd->postproc.addnoise = vp8_plane_add_noise_wmt;
#endif
}
#endif
#if HAVE_SSE3
if (flags & HAS_SSE3)
{
rtcd->variance.sad16x16 = vp8_sad16x16_sse3;
rtcd->variance.sad16x16x3 = vp8_sad16x16x3_sse3;
rtcd->variance.sad16x8x3 = vp8_sad16x8x3_sse3;
rtcd->variance.sad8x16x3 = vp8_sad8x16x3_sse3;
rtcd->variance.sad8x8x3 = vp8_sad8x8x3_sse3;
rtcd->variance.sad4x4x3 = vp8_sad4x4x3_sse3;
rtcd->variance.sad16x16x4d = vp8_sad16x16x4d_sse3;
rtcd->variance.sad16x8x4d = vp8_sad16x8x4d_sse3;
rtcd->variance.sad8x16x4d = vp8_sad8x16x4d_sse3;
rtcd->variance.sad8x8x4d = vp8_sad8x8x4d_sse3;
rtcd->variance.sad4x4x4d = vp8_sad4x4x4d_sse3;
rtcd->variance.copy32xn = vp8_copy32xn_sse3;
}
#endif
#if HAVE_SSSE3
if (flags & HAS_SSSE3)
{
rtcd->subpix.sixtap16x16 = vp8_sixtap_predict16x16_ssse3;
rtcd->subpix.sixtap8x8 = vp8_sixtap_predict8x8_ssse3;
rtcd->subpix.sixtap8x4 = vp8_sixtap_predict8x4_ssse3;
rtcd->subpix.sixtap4x4 = vp8_sixtap_predict4x4_ssse3;
rtcd->subpix.bilinear16x16 = vp8_bilinear_predict16x16_ssse3;
rtcd->subpix.bilinear8x8 = vp8_bilinear_predict8x8_ssse3;
rtcd->recon.build_intra_predictors_mbuv =
vp8_build_intra_predictors_mbuv_ssse3;
rtcd->recon.build_intra_predictors_mbuv_s =
vp8_build_intra_predictors_mbuv_s_ssse3;
rtcd->recon.build_intra_predictors_mby =
vp8_build_intra_predictors_mby_ssse3;
rtcd->recon.build_intra_predictors_mby_s =
vp8_build_intra_predictors_mby_s_ssse3;
rtcd->variance.sad16x16x3 = vp8_sad16x16x3_ssse3;
rtcd->variance.sad16x8x3 = vp8_sad16x8x3_ssse3;
rtcd->variance.subpixvar16x8 = vp8_sub_pixel_variance16x8_ssse3;
rtcd->variance.subpixvar16x16 = vp8_sub_pixel_variance16x16_ssse3;
}
#endif
#if HAVE_SSE4_1
if (flags & HAS_SSE4_1)
{
rtcd->variance.sad16x16x8 = vp8_sad16x16x8_sse4;
rtcd->variance.sad16x8x8 = vp8_sad16x8x8_sse4;
rtcd->variance.sad8x16x8 = vp8_sad8x16x8_sse4;
rtcd->variance.sad8x8x8 = vp8_sad8x8x8_sse4;
rtcd->variance.sad4x4x8 = vp8_sad4x4x8_sse4;
}
#endif
#endif
}
